Attention Deficit Disorder (ADHD) is a neurodevelopmental disorder that impacts countless individuals worldwide. Defined by symptoms such as impulsivity, negligence, and hyperactivity, ADHD can substantially impact every day life, academic performance, and relationships. Many individuals wonder, "Do I have ADHD?" If you believe that you might have ADHD however are reluctant to look for a formal diagnosis, there are various free resources available for initial self-assessment.
Comprehending ADHD
ADHD can emerge in different methods depending on the individual. The symptoms generally fall under two categories: negligence and hyperactivity-impulsivity. It is vital to recognize that showing some of these habits does not always imply someone has ADHD.

While a conclusive diagnosis ought to constantly be made by a qualified healthcare professional, numerous free self-assessment tools are readily available online. These tests can assist individuals acquire insights into whether they might show symptoms of ADHD.
Typical Self-Assessment Tools
Adult ADHD Self-Report Scale (ASRS-v1.1)
A commonly utilized screening tool that consists of 18 questions based upon DSM-5 criteria.
Conners 3 ADHD Index
A questionnaire typically utilized by educators and clinicians. While the complete assessment requires a cost, a short kind is normally available free of charge.
Vanderbilt ADHD Diagnostic Parent Rating Scale
Mainly for children but can supply insight into familial patterns if you're a parent observing traits in your kid.
Mind Diagnostics ADHD Test

If initial assessments recommend the capacity for ADHD, it's crucial to look for further examination from a psychiatrist or psychologist. An appropriate diagnosis typically involves:

Can I self-diagnose ADHD?
While self-assessment tools can provide insights, they are not alternatives to a professional diagnosis. Only a psychological health expert can identify ADHD.
2. What should I do if I believe I have ADHD?
If you suspect you have ADHD, think about taking a self-assessment quiz for preliminary insights. Following this, consult with a doctor for more evaluation.
3. Are there specific age more impacted by ADHD?
ADHD is frequently diagnosed in childhood, however numerous adults likewise suffer from undiagnosed ADHD. Symptoms can persist into the adult years and in some cases only end up being apparent later in life.
4. What factors add to the advancement of ADHD?
ADHD is thought to originate from a combination of genetic, environmental, and neurological aspects. Household history, exposure to toxins, and premature birth can increase the risk.

If identified with ADHD, different treatment alternatives might include medication, behavioral therapy, lifestyle modifications, and coping techniques for handling symptoms successfully.
Tips for Managing ADHD Symptoms
If you think that you or a liked one might have ADHD, here are some pointers to help handle traits related to the disorder:
Create a Structured Environment: Use organizers, tips, and lists to stay organized.Enhance Time Management: Break tasks into smaller, workable parts and use timers for focused work sessions.Focus on Self-Care: Ensure routine exercise and a well balanced diet plan.Practice Mindfulness: Techniques such as meditation or yoga can assist enhance focus and decrease impulsivity.Seek Support: Join support system or look for therapy for both psychological support and practical recommendations.
